Chorley Station ensures a seamless ticketing experience with its easily accessible ticket office and machines. The ticket office operates from 06:25 to early evenings on weekdays and extends later into the evening on Saturdays, ensuring ample time for ticket purchases. For those who prefer digital convenience, smartcards are issued at the station, accompanied by validators for a swift and hassle-free check-in.
Your safety and comfort are paramount, with the station being equipped with CCTV. Although there are no waiting areas or first-class lounges, seating is available for your convenience. It's worth noting that while the station is fully equipped with steps and ramps for step-free access, it does fall short in terms of some accessible facilities such as accessible toilets and waiting rooms.
Chorley Station is fantastically connected to various transport modes. If your journey involves buses, the nearby bus interchange on Shepherd’s Way caters to connections for routes towards Bolton and Preston. Additionally, for those looking to conveniently book a cab, resources such as the [Cab4You service](https://www.northernrailway.co.uk/tickets/cab4you) offer easy online taxi reservations.
Although bicycle hire isn't available directly at the station, the local vicinity provides opportunities for cycling enthusiasts to explore further.

It's important to note that Morfa Mawddach station doesn't have a ticket office or ticket machines, so you'll need to secure your train tickets in advance or through online purchases. While this might mean a little extra planning, it also ensures you can focus on what's most important—enjoying the journey. The station provides minimal facilities, which only helps in preserving its serene atmosphere. With step-free access to platform areas, it holds a Category B2 accessibility rating. This makes it somewhat convenient for individuals with reduced mobility, although it's worth checking ahead if assistance is needed during your travels.
Even with its quaint nature, Morfa Mawddach offers multiple transport links for further exploration. During service disruptions, a rail replacement bus service is accessible from the station’s car park. Local bus services can be found approximately 650 meters away on the A493, leading to exciting places like Dolgellau, Aberystwyth, and Machynlleth. Do keep in mind that while bicycle hire is mentioned, there are no actual facilities at the station, so arranging cycling plans in advance would be prudent.
